Pros

- Great mix of people. Most with the best intentions. - Relatively flat organization (aside from obvious mgmt roles) - Exposure to huge brands/clients without many layers - Work/life balance is centric to the culture (gym reimbursement, wellness guest speakers, etc.) - Create your own path: Hhave a good idea? Throw it at the wall and see who picks it up before it hits the floor. More often than not, I've found that people listen and run with good ideas. - Relatively nimble and quick to pivot - The NetLine Lounge - Free drinks every Friday night and other random events/evenings. This is a new addition this year and personal favorite 'perk'

Cons

- Some employees are a bit too comfortable - Maybe the work/life balance is a little too flexible? Hard to say considering this is the valley. - Most sales reps are remote and not connected to the day-to-day inner-workings at the office. - A little too quiet for my liking in the office but I'm one of the more vocal/out-going people here. I guess some people like to put their head down and focus on their work. Maybe a more open floor plan would help to foster more interaction? - Some reps clearly are pulling their weight (if not exceeding) while others clearly hide via working at their 'home office'. I get the sense that more hungry reps in the HQ would be a positive for both the reps and the company as a whole.
